Ingredients for Peach Cobbler Cheesecake Fruit Salad

  • 4 cups fresh peaches, diced: Sweet, ripe peaches form the star of the show. Look for vibrant colors and a fragrant aroma. Substitute with other fruits like nectarines or berries if desired for variety.
  • 8 oz cream cheese, softened: Cream cheese brings richness and depth. Don’t skimp on softening it first for the smoothest consistency.
  • 1/2 cup powdered sugar: Adds sweetness without the graininess of granulated sugar; it integrates seamlessly into the mix.
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ract: This elevates the flavor profile, offering warmth and depth. Use pure vanilla for the best quality.
  • 1 cup whipped cream: This ingredient adds lightness and creaminess while making the dessert feel more indulgent.
  • 1 cup granola (for topping): The crunch of granola offers a delightful contrast to the smooth, creamy filling and juicy peaches.
  • 1/2 tsp cinnamon (optional): Though optional, it brings a comforting warmth that greatly enhances the overall experience.
  • Mint leaves (for garnish, optional): Their bright green appearance adds vibrancy and a refreshing aroma to the dish.

How to Make Peach Cobbler Cheesecake Fruit Salad

  1. Begin by beating the softened cream cheese in a large bowl. Add the powdered sugar and vanilla extract, blending until the mixture is remarkably smooth and creamy. Take a moment to appreciate the cloud-like texture.
  2. Gently fold in the whipped cream until well combined, creating a luscious mixture that will embrace the peaches perfectly. Be careful—this step can easily deflate your whipped cream if you stir too vigorously.
  3. Add the freshly diced peaches to your creamy mixture, carefully stirring until every peach slice is coated in the delightful cheesecake concoction. Relish the vibrant colors as they mingle.
  4. If you wish, sprinkle cinnamon over the mixture for a touch of warmth. It complements the sweet peaches and adds a cozy aroma that’s irresistible.
  5. Chill the salad in the refrigerator for about 30 minutes. This step brings the flavors together, allowing each ingredient to shine harmoniously.
  6. Finally, serve in beautiful bowls, topping each serving with a sprinkle of granola and fresh mint leaves for that perfect finish. Feel the anticipation build as you present this stunning creation.

Chef’s Notes & Helpful Tips

  • Make-ahead Tips: Prepare this salad a few hours beforehand to let the flavors meld beautifully. However, add the granola right before serving to keep that satisfying crunch.
  • Cooking Alternatives: You can play with other types of fruit, such as blueberries or strawberries, or even add a splash of lemon juice for a citrusy kick.
  • Customization Ideas: Experiment with swirls of caramel or chocolate sauce, or consider adding chopped pecans for additional crunch. The possibilities are endless, making each batch uniquely your own.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  1. Using cold cream cheese: Always soften cream cheese to ensure a smooth, creamy texture; nobody desires lumps in their salad!
  2. Overmixing the whipped cream: Stop mixing once soft peaks form. Overwhipping leads to a grainy texture that detracts from the experience.
  3. Skipping the chill: Don’t skip the refrigerating step; chilling enhances flavors and allows the salad to firm up perfectly.

Storage & Reheating Instructions

For optimal freshness, store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ator. Enjoy within two days for the best flavor and texture. Freezing is not recommended due to the delicate nature of whipped cream and cream cheese mixture.

FAQs

Can I use canned peaches instead of fresh?
Certainly! If fresh peaches are not available, opt for canned ones packed in juice. Ensure to drain them well to prevent excess liquid.

Is it possible to make this vegan?
Absolutely! Replace cream cheese with vegan alternatives and use coconut whipped cream for a dairy-free version.

What kind of granola should I use?
Choose a granola that you enjoy—opt for a plain version or one with various nuts and dried fruits for added texture and flavor.

Can I add other fruits?
Yes! Berries like raspberries or blueberries complement peaches beautifully, creating more depth and variety in your salad.

Will it still taste good after being stored?
While the salad is best enjoyed fresh, it retains much of its delicious flavor for about two days. However, added granola should be served separately to maintain its crunch.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 4 cups fresh peaches, diced
  • 8 oz cream cheese, softened
  • 1/2 cup powdered sugar
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1 cup whipped cream
  • 1 cup granola (for topping)
  • 1/2 tsp cinnamon (optional)
  • Mint leaves (for garnish, optional)

Instructions

  1. Beat the softened cream cheese in a large bowl. Add the powdered sugar and vanilla extract, blending until smooth.
  2. Fold in the whipped cream until well combined.
  3. Add the diced peaches and gently stir until coated.
  4. Sprinkle cinnamon over the mixture if desired.
  5. Chill the salad in the refrigerator for about 30 minutes.
  6. Serve in bowls, topping with granola and mint leaves.

Notes

Make-ahead up to a few hours in advance, but add granola right before serving to keep it crunchy.
